That Can Benefit From Cold Laser Therapy?



If you deal with chronic pain, cold laser treatment can offer you significant alleviation. This non-invasive therapy has been located to be advantageous for a vast array of problems, including joint inflammation, tendonitis, and muscular tissue stress. Whether you're an athlete dealing with sporting activities injuries or a specific experiencing everyday aches and pains, cold laser therapy may be able to help alleviate your pain.

In addition, if you're looking for a drug-free choice to handling discomfort, cold laser therapy could be a suitable choice for you. By using low-level laser light to stimulate recovery at the cellular level, this therapy advertises tissue repair service and minimizes swelling, resulting in enhanced pain administration without making use of drugs.

Prospective Threats and Side Effects



When considering cold laser therapy, it is essential to be knowledgeable about the prospective threats and adverse effects related to this treatment. While cold laser treatment is usually considered secure, there are a couple of feasible negative effects to bear in mind.

Some individuals may experience mild pain during the therapy, such as a slight tingling sensation or heat in the targeted location. In uncommon instances, skin irritation or soreness at the site of treatment may occur.

Additionally, there's a small risk of eye injury if the laser is routed towards the eyes. It's crucial for both the patient and the specialist to wear protective glasses during the therapy to stop any accidental exposure to the eyes.

Moreover, cold laser treatment shouldn't be done over areas with energetic malignant lumps or on people that are expectant, as the results of the treatment in these cases aren't well understood.

Security Factors To Consider for Certain Teams



Consider the safety and security considerations for certain groups when undertaking cold laser therapy to ensure ideal treatment outcomes.

People with a pacemaker or various other implanted digital devices ought to notify their healthcare provider before therapy, as the laser's electromagnetic radiation could possibly disrupt these devices.

Additionally, individuals taking photosensitizing medicines must understand that cold laser therapy could enhance their sensitivity to light, potentially bring about unfavorable responses.
